She is apt to fits of depression.

Vocabulary list

kanojo
pronoun
  1. she; her
noun
  1. girlfriend
ha
particle
  1. topic marker particle (pronounced わ in modern Japanese)
  2. indicates contrast with another option (stated or unstated)
  3. adds emphasis
kyuuni
adverb
  1. swiftly; rapidly; quickly; immediately; hastily; hurriedly
  2. suddenly; abruptly; unexpectedly
  3. sharply (of a slope, bend, etc.); steeply
kyuu
na adjective
  1. sudden; abrupt; unexpected
  2. urgent; pressing
  3. steep; sharp; precipitous
  4. rapid; swift; fast
noun
  1. emergency; crisis; danger
  2. urgency; hurrying; haste
  3. (in gagaku or noh) end of a song
ni
particle
  1. at (place, time); in; on; during
  2. to (direction, state); toward; into
  3. for (purpose)
  4. because of (reason); for; with
  5. by; from
  6. as (i.e. in the role of)
  7. per; in; for; a (e.g. "once a month")
  8. and; in addition to
  9. if; although
fusagikomu
godan verb, intransitive verb
  1. to mope; to brood; to be in low spirits; to have the blues
seiheki
noun
  1. disposition; inclination; characteristic; idiosyncrasy; propensity
  2. sexual disposition; fetish
ga
particle
  1. indicates sentence subject (occasionally object)
  2. indicates possessive (esp. in literary expressions)
conjunction
  1. but; however; still; and
  2. regardless of; whether (or not) (after the volitional form of a verb)
aru
godan verb (irregular), intransitive verb
  1. to be; to exist; to live (usu. of inanimate objects)
  2. to have
  3. to be located
  4. to be equipped with
  5. to happen; to come about
